If the next few months play out perfectly as the Miami Heat hope they will, it will end with the team acquiring Giannis Antetokounmpo during the offseason. According to NBA insider Michael Scotto, that's the team's dream scenario during the summer.

"Rival NBA executives who spoke with HoopsHype believe the Heat’s dream scenario is acquiring Antetokounmpo if he becomes available over the summer, when they have more draft capital to include in a trade offer. "

This is not exactly breaking news if you've been closely following the Heat over the last couple of years. In fact, the Heat have been linked to Giannis for years now. It started back in 2020, when he was deciding whether to sign a long-term deal with Milwaukee or explore other options. Ultimately, Giannis decided to sign long-term with the Bucks, and it led to a championship in 2021.

The Heat have been waiting for their opportunity to pursue Giannis

Since then, though, the Heat have been keeping one eye on Giannis. They may have a real shot at him during the summer, when Giannis will have to make a similar decision about his future.

This time, though, there is wide speculation that expect Giannis and the Bucks to part ways. It's far from a guarantee, especially with the way Giannis has been speaking of late, but it's probably the closest we've ever been to this happening.

And the Heat know this.

That's part of the reason why they've been so hesitant to make any other big roster moves, including a potential all-out pursuit for Ja Morant.

At least for now, the Heat doesn't appear to be willing to include any real assets for Morant. In the event they need all hands on deck for a potential Giannis pursuit, it would be dubious to realize that they wasting a real chance at the superstar forward because of Morant.
